Elevare Awarded WEConnect International Certification

We are delighted to announce that Elevare has been awarded the Certified Women’s Business Enterprise credential by WEConnect International

WEConnect International, is a global network that connects women-owned businesses, enabling them to compete and succeed in the global marketplace.

The benefits of WEConnect International Certification include: 

  • WEConnect International members are large organisations committed to global supplier diversity and inclusion that help build sustainable communities by sourcing from women-owned businesses around the globe.
  • One-third of all privately owned businesses in the world are owned by women, yet women-owned businesses earn less than 1% of large corporate and government spend with suppliers.
  • Being part of the WEConnect International Network means supporting supplier diversity at a global level. Breaking down the barriers that are currently in place to new opportunities, markets and capital is essential for the survival of women-owned businesses. 
  • The gender pay gap in Ireland is currently at 14.4%, which is slightly ahead over the OECD average of 16%. As a member of WEConnect International we can promote full economic gender parity – which would contribute significantly to the country’s GDP.
